Southwest College Of Naturopathic Medicine And Health Sciences

Doctor of Naturopathic Medicine

Program Information

Degree Offered

N.D.- Naturopathic Doctorate

Program Description:

Four-year graduate-level medical program that is accredited by the Council on Naturopathic Medical Education and the Higher Learning Commission of the North Central Association resulting in a Naturopathic Medicine Degree (ND). Studies concentrate on the latest advances in science in combination with natural approaches to therapy, disease prevention, and clinical education in all modalities. The program exceeds the minimum required credit/clock hours of instruction set by the Council on Naturopathic Medical Education. Graduates are eligible to sit for professional board exams within licensed states to obtain licensure as a Naturopathic physician.

Accreditation:

CNME and HLC of NCA

International Student Requirements:

Transcripts from international institutions must be translated and evaluated by an international transcript evaluation service. Fees for this service are the responsibility of the applicant. The applicant must request a subject analysis transcript evaluation. The report must be mailed directly to the SCNM Admissions Office and received before an evaluation of the applicant’s file can begin. Additional coursework materials, such as catalogs, course descriptions, and syllabi, if requested, must be translated into English by a professional service. SCNM reserves the right to require international applicants whose native language is not English to take the Test of English as a Foreign Language (TOEFL). International applicants must submit a financial guarantee form and provide proof of sufficient financial resources to the Admissions Office to cover anticipated costs of study. The Dean of Students Office will issue a Department of Homeland Security (INS) I-20 form for student visas.
